A young Bellshill woman was amongst 5 people who sadly died in a horror crash in Dundalk in County Louth.
21 year old Chloe Hipson was one of 5 people named by police who lost their lives on Saturday evening.
They have been named as: Chloe McGee, 23, from Carrickmacross, County Monaghan; Alan McCluskey, 23, from Drumconrath, County Meath; Dillon Commins, 23, from Drumconrath, County Meath; Shay Duffy, 21, Carrickmacross, County Monaghan; Chloe Hipson, 21, from Lanarkshire, Scotland.
It is understood that the young people who died may have been travelling to a location to socialise when the crash occurred.
Irish President Catherine Connolly said she is “deeply saddened and shocked by the loss of five precious young lives in Louth last night”. She added: “I am thinking of them, their families and of those injured.
